Transaction 09cf0ddacca64ff1765bd71a9b9601c4e8010c06c0b77de8af70e60020608173

block
2575bc1d1e8ee8333ec072b80382b62ec5b1156f854eb7105dfcb7677d7618cd

2 Inputs

26 Outputs